Chris Sinha`s central research interest is in the relations between language, cognition and culture, and a main aim of his research is to integrate cognitive linguistic with socio-cultural approaches to language and communication, including its acquisition and development. He is currently Partner leader for the University of Portsmouth in the EU 6th Framework NEST/Pathfinder Project “Stages in the Evolution and Development of Sign Use”, funded under the “What it Means to be Human” programme. He is President of the UK Cognitive Linguistics Association.
